Types of Farm Irrigation Pumps Uganda Farmers Use Today
The main types of farm irrigation pumps Uganda farmers use include diesel pumps, petrol pumps, and submersible pumps, each suited for different farm sizes, water depths, and irrigation requirements.
1. Diesel Pumps
Used for large-scale irrigation and long operating hours.
2. Petrol Pumps
Best for small to medium farms requiring mobility and lower cost entry.
3. Submersible Pumps
Ideal for deep boreholes and permanent irrigation infrastructure.

1. Diesel Farm Irrigation Pumps Uganda Commercial Farmers Prefer
Diesel farm irrigation pumps Uganda commercial farmers prefer are high-capacity systems designed for long operational cycles, high water flow rates, and fuel-efficient performance under heavy agricultural workloads.
These pumps are widely used in large farms across Nakasongola and Karamoja where irrigation must cover multiple acres daily.

Diesel Pump Specifications
| Specification | Range |
|---|---|
| Engine Type | 4-stroke diesel |
| Power Output | 5HP – 15HP |
| Flow Rate | 30–100 m³/hr |
| Head Height | 20–70 meters |
| Fuel Capacity | 3L – 12L |
| Runtime | 6–12 hours |
Key Advantages:
- High torque output
- Suitable for continuous irrigation
- Lower fuel consumption per hectare
- Strong performance in hot climates

2. Petrol Farm Irrigation Pumps Uganda Smallholders Use
Petrol farm irrigation pumps Uganda smallholders use are lightweight, portable systems designed for small farms, greenhouse irrigation, and short-duration watering cycles.
These pumps are ideal for farmers managing:
- 1–5 acre plots
- Vegetable farms
- Nursery beds
- Small irrigation schemes

Petrol Pump Specifications
| Specification | Range |
|---|---|
| Engine Type | 4-stroke petrol |
| Power Output | 3HP – 7HP |
| Flow Rate | 20–60 m³/hr |
| Head Height | 15–45 meters |
| Weight | 20–45 kg |
| Startup | Recoil |
Key Advantages:
- Easy transport
- Low purchase cost
- Fast startup
- Simple maintenance

3. Submersible Farm Irrigation Pumps Uganda Borehole Systems Depend On
Submersible farm irrigation pumps Uganda borehole systems depend on are electric pumps designed to operate underwater, delivering consistent water pressure from deep groundwater sources without suction limitations.
They are critical in drought-prone regions where surface water is unavailable.

Submersible Pump Specifications
| Specification | Range |
|---|---|
| Depth Range | 20–150 meters |
| Flow Rate | 10–80 m³/hr |
| Motor Power | 0.5HP – 15HP |
| Cooling | Water-cooled |
| Installation | Borehole |
Key Advantages:
- No priming required
- High efficiency in deep wells
- Stable irrigation pressure
- Suitable for solar integration
Submersible farm irrigation pumps Uganda farmers install are increasingly important for long-term irrigation infrastructure.
Comparison of Farm Irrigation Pumps Uganda Farmers Use
| Feature | Diesel | Petrol | Submersible |
|---|---|---|---|
| Best Use | Large farms | Small farms | Boreholes |
| Fuel Efficiency | High | Moderate | Electric |
| Portability | Medium | High | Low |
| Maintenance | Moderate | Low | Moderate |
| Cost | High | Low | High |

Maintenance Tips for Farm Irrigation Pumps Uganda Daily Use
Proper maintenance of Uganda farmers use ensures durability, fuel efficiency, and uninterrupted irrigation cycles during peak agricultural seasons.
Maintenance Checklist:
- Clean air filters daily
- Check oil levels weekly
- Inspect hoses for leaks
- Flush pump after use
- Service engine monthly
